Pegatron Receive Orders 15 Million iPhones 5

DigiTimes site reported a 5 iPhone orders from Apple for Pegatron Technology. The number of orders that reach 15 million units to be sent to Apple in July.

According to 'insiders' Pegatron Technology, iPhone 5 does not have much difference with the iPhone 4. Meanwhile, suppliers of hardware for Apple is now in the process of sending the iPhone component 5 that they have made to the headquarters Pegatron Technology in Shanghai, China.

Apple's decision to use the services Pegatron Technology for the iPhone assembly 5 is not separated from the satisfaction received previously. It was associated with the success of fulfilling orders Technology Pegratron of 10 million units Apple iPhone 4 CDMA for Verizon. Along with the decline in demand for iPhone 4 (because the iPhone 5 immediate release) and Pegatron is now in serious financial trouble, one of his business is to get the order from Apple for both iPad and MacBook. Unfortunately, so far Apple has not entrust both products at Pegatron.

In addition DigiTimes also wrote about the existence of 5 million units of the iPad 2 touch sensors which will also be sent this month. TPK Holding and Wintek become a major supplier to the respective handle 1.5 million units. The rest will be made ​​by Cando, Sintek Photronic and Chimei Innolux.
